2009-05-14 2 views
0

asp.net 응용 프로그램 (vb)에서 Crystal Reports를 사용하여 보고서를 만들었습니다. 괜찮 았어. 그러나 다른 시스템에서 실행하면 보고서로드가 실패합니다. 그래서 나는 이렇게 코드를 수정했다. Asp.net에서 Crystal Reports를 사용하는 동안의 문제

sub Loadreport() 
try 
Dim sreport as new ReportDocument 
sreport.Load(Server.MapPath("ClientList.rpt")) 
sreport.FileName=Server.MapPath("ClientList.rpt") 

catch(ex.exception) 

end try 
End sub 

컨트롤 라인에 관해서

: -

sreport.Load(Server.MapPath("ClientList.rpt")) 

는 "잘못된 보고서 경로"를 보여주는 catch 블록으로 이동합니다. 그러나 처음에는 코드가 오류를 표시하지 않았습니다. 나는 그 길을 바꾸지 않았다. 뭐가 문제 야?

답변

0

추적 파일이나 오류 로그에 경로를 기록하거나 reponse.write하고 "다른 시스템"의 경로가 ClientList.rpt가 저장된 올바른 경로인지 확인하십시오.

관련 문제